Definition of

Water-soluble Vitamin

  1. (noun, substance) any vitamin that is soluble in water

via WordNet, Princeton University

Alternate forms of Water-soluble Vitamin

Hyponyms: ascorbic acid, b, b complex, b vitamin, b-complex vitamin, bioflavinoid, c, citrin, vitamin b, vitamin b complex, vitamin c, vitamin p

Hypernyms: vitamin

